I need the torque specs for the front suspension on a 1995 Explorer 4.0 4WD. I don't currently have a service manual. I am going to be replacing the lower ball joints and want to make sure that I get everything torqued to spec when I am done replacing the joints. specifically I need the specs for the front axle hubs, lower ball joint studs, upper control arm to knuckle bolts, and tie-rod ends.

Many Thanks,
Matt
 






balljoint 83-113
tierod to spindle 45-60
spindle pinch bolt 30-40 (? seems low)
wheel hub nut 157-213
hub to knuckle 70-80
